WebThe Ship Brothers 1750 List 152 C At the Court House at Philadelphia, Friday, the 24th August, 1750. Present: Thomas Lawrence, Esquire, Mayor. The Foreigners whose Names are underwritten, imported in the Ship Brothers, Captn Muir, from Rotterdam & last from Cowes, did this day take & subscribe the usual Oaths.

WebWritten by Portia Tremlett, Public Programme Engagement Officer at The Novium Museum. The story of Shippam's begins in 1750, when the grocer Sergeant Shipston Shippam opened premises at West Gate selling butter, cheese and meat which he collected from the West Country. Until about 1750, the Royal Navy was extremely conservative, with development and experimentation being greatly restricted by the system of Establishments. The Establishments. From the late 17th century, the Royal Navy began to standardize its ships.
